Repacking for shipment
Repacking for shipment
The shipping carton has been carefully designed to protect the Alarm Panel
and its accessories during shipment. This carton and its associated packing
material should be used when repacking for shipment. Attach a tag indicating
the type of service required, return address, model number and full serial
number. Mark the carton FRAGILE to ensure careful handling.
If the original shipping carton is not available, the following general
instructions should be used for repacking with commercially available
material.
1. Wrap the Alarm Panel in heavy paper or plastic. Attach a tag indicating the
type of service required, return address, model number and full serial
number.
2. Use a strong shipping container, e.g. a double walled carton of 160 kg test
material.
3. Protect the front- and rear panel with cardboard and insert a 7 cm to 10 cm
layer of shock-absorbing material between all surfaces of the equipment
and the sides of the container.
4. Seal the shipping container securely.
5. Mark the shipping container FRAGILE to ensure careful handling.
